Mendocino Mustangs is holding its 18th Annual Mothers Day Weekend Mustang Car Show on Saturday May 7 from 9am to 3pm in the Pear Tree Shopping Center. A short half-hour cruise will follow the show.

There are "people's choice" awards for:
-Best of Show
-Best Stock
-Best Modified
-1974 to Present
-Convertibles
-Daily Drivers

No fees of any kind - Parking begins at 8:30

ALL Mustang Owners Welcomed

It was a lot of fun. There were around 40 cars. I was suprised that many were there.

I took nearly 250 photos. There's a sampling (22 shots) over at http://www.bobbeltrami.com/mmshow05.htm (If you're on dial-up, be patient.)

I was also suprised at the mix of cars. There were 5 2005's: 4 satin silver, 1 windveil blue. There were only 5 sn95's, two of them were Mach 1's. There was one fox... an '87 ASC McLaren vert (VERY clean). All the rest were classics. It was very cool to see so many of the originals in great shape and in good hands.
